Output d26edf23d87dc37cde0667b5bb2e9d14affc6c076439223a7e32fe97f4b6bf1f:0

value
7853251
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9aa19a7868bd6f8906b8695a095e9e237983a2fb OP_EQUAL
address
3FndaVBXLxdtdzgr1jH3xSXWMbK9T7HRuN
transaction
d26edf23d87dc37cde0667b5bb2e9d14affc6c076439223a7e32fe97f4b6bf1f
confirmations
142431
spent
true